Cristiano Ronaldo Joins Fatal Fury: City of the Wolves as Guest Fighter

Guest characters have become a well-established trend in fighting games, with titles like Tekken 7 featuring Akuma, Soulcalibur IV including Yoda, and Injustice 2 adding the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les as DLC. However, the announcement of soccer icon Cristiano Ronaldo joining the playable roster of the upcoming Fatal Fury: City of the Wolves marks a particularly unique and unexpected guest inclusion for the franchise.

A Football Legend Enters the Ring

Cristiano Ronaldo, widely considered among the greatest football players of all time and holder of numerous records and accolades, is set to join the main playable cast in Fatal Fury: City of the Wolves. Representing his home country of Portugal in international competition, Ronaldo’s club career has included stints with Manchester United, Real Madrid, and Juventus. Since 2023, he has been playing for Al Nassr in Saudi Arabia.

Ronaldo’s Fighting Style: Football Meets Martial Arts

In Fatal Fury: City of the Wolves, Juan Felipe Sierra provides the voice for Ronaldo. Within the game, Ronaldo utilizes techniques honed during his illustrious football career to combat opponents. His fighting style is described as a blend of “Football + Martial Arts.” A reveal trailer showcasing this unique style is available below.

Roster Expansion and Upcoming DLC

Ronaldo’s addition expands the current main roster to 15 characters, and this number could potentially increase before the game’s launch next month. Furthermore, downloadable content (DLC) is planned, with SNK having previously announced that two guest characters, Ken and Chun-Li from the Street Fighter series, will be added to the roster post-launch. Fatal Fury: City of the Wolves is scheduled for release on April 24 for P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X/S, PlayStation 4, and PC. Fans eager to familiarize themselves with existing Fatal Fury characters can note that Mai Shiranui and Terry Bogard have joined the Street Fighter 6 roster as DLC throughout 2024.
